抓住Oracle体验它的便利与精彩(oracle 体验版)

Oracle是一款功能强大的数据库管理系统,是许多企业和机构的首选。如果您想了解Oracle的便利和精彩,这篇文章将帮助您打开大门。

Oracle的优势

Oracle有很多优点。以下是最重要的一些:

1. 可扩展性:Oracle可以处理数百万个用户,因此适用于大型企业和网站。

2. 高性能:Oracle的吞吐量和响应速度非常高,可以有效地处理高速交易。

3. 高安全性:Oracle提供了多层安全性功能,包括访问控制、加密和审计。

4. 可靠性:Oracle具有强大的灾难恢复和备份能力。在出现故障时,它可以自动切换到备用服务器上。

抓住Oracle,了解它的便利

如果您是一个Oracle的新手,以下是一些有助于您快速掌握Oracle的便利的技巧。

1. 安装Oracle数据库:Oracle提供了一个易于使用的安装向导,可以帮助您在几分钟内安装Oracle数据库。

2. 创建表格:Oracle中的关系数据库包含表格。使用CREATE TABLE语句可以创建一个表格。

例如,要创建一个名为“student”的表格,其中包含3个字段:id,name和age,请使用以下代码:

CREATE TABLE student (

id int NOT NULL,

name VARCHAR(255) NOT NULL,

age int NOT NULL,

PRIMARY KEY (id)

);

3. 插入数据:使用INSERT INTO语句将数据插入表格中。例如,要将学生1、2和3插入“student”表格,请使用以下代码:

INSERT INTO student (id, name, age)

VALUES (1, ‘Tom’, 20), (2, ‘Jerry’, 21), (3, ‘Lucy’, 22);

4. 查询数据:使用SELECT语句从表格中检索数据。例如,要检索所有学生的姓名和年龄,请使用以下代码:

SELECT name, age FROM student;

抓住Oracle,体验它的精彩

如果您已经掌握了Oracle的基础知识,以下是一些可以帮助您体验Oracle精彩功能的技巧。

1. 使用索引:Oracle的索引可以大幅提高查询速度。使用CREATE INDEX语句可以创建索引。

例如,要为“student”表格的“age”字段创建索引,请使用以下代码:

CREATE INDEX age_index ON student (age);

2. 使用存储过程:存储过程是一组预定义的SQL语句,可以使用它们来执行共同的任务。

例如,要创建一个将学生年龄加1的存储过程,请使用以下代码:

CREATE PROCEDURE add_age AS

BEGIN

UPDATE student SET age = age + 1;

END;

3. 使用触发器:Oracle的触发器可以在数据库发生某些操作时自动执行SQL语句。

例如,要创建一个在删除学生时自动删除所有课程评分的触发器,请使用以下代码:

CREATE TRIGGER delete_grade

AFTER DELETE ON student

FOR EACH ROW

BEGIN

DELETE FROM grade WHERE student_id = :OLD.id;

END;

结论

Oracle是一个强大的数据库管理系统,适用于大型企业和网站。通过使用Oracle的基础知识和高级功能,可以使您的数据库更快、更可靠、更安全。相信您会喜欢这款数据库管理系统的便利与精彩。


数据运维技术 » 抓住Oracle体验它的便利与精彩(oracle 体验版)